Word Meaning 話の腰を折る

はなしのこしをおる hanashi no koshi o oru

話の腰を折る is read as はなしのこしをおる (hanashi no koshi o oru) and means to interfere.

Meaning

English

  1. to interfere
  2. to butt in
  3. to interrupt someone
